The X-CORE lateral spine procedure is a minimally invasive surgical technique used to treat lower back conditions caused by damaged or collapsed spinal discs.
It involves placing a strong supportive spacer (implant) between the spinal bones through a small incision from the side of the body, helping restore disc height, relieve nerve pressure, and stabilise the spine—while minimising disruption to back muscles.
Your spine surgeon will determine whether this lateral approach is appropriate based on your anatomy and condition.
